Transaction 329432edd40e7d8fb18979de007f8866dd91eeaec9e38364fef397755b9dfe6c

1 Input
2 Outputs
  • 329432edd40e7d8fb18979de007f8866dd91eeaec9e38364fef397755b9dfe6c:0
  • value  1094986
    address  3MLhHmJVgeHuxV1U5ECAcq2G5JtkVVXFwR
  • 329432edd40e7d8fb18979de007f8866dd91eeaec9e38364fef397755b9dfe6c:1
  • value  3797602
    address  12SRmV5wXeZeX27UDRM4YpyX6CxRiwxxVr